Description
Telford and Wrekin Council is looking to procure experienced technical expertise with proven skills in carrying out an options appraisal for the future delivery of the Grounds Maintenance and Street Cleansing service, whether this a wholly externalised service, an in-house only service or mix of in-house and outsourcing. The Council's ground maintenance and street cleansing service is currently delivered through an outsourced contract which will expire at the end of March 2019. The Council is currently considering the best delivery option for the service beyond this time; work has commenced on an options appraisal, but the Council now requires independent expertise to complete the work and make recommendations on the best delivery model for the future operation of the service, taking into account the Council's continuing objectives of reducing costs, enhancing flexibility and improving quality of the service The Council requires commercially focussed and financial expertise with experience of advising local authorities on complex local authority in-sourcing and out-sourcing projects for grounds maintenance and street cleansing to complete the work, this is likely to be needed from early October 2016 to mid November 2016.
